    Understanding the Volvo V50 Key Types

    Before diving into where to discover a replacement, it’s important to comprehend the kind of keys your Volvo V50 utilizes. The Volvo V50 generally requires a distinct key that might be:

    1. Traditional Key: These keys have an easy design and do not include any electronic elements.
    2. Transponder Key: These keys have a microchip ingrained inside that communicates with the car to avoid theft.
    3. Smart Key/ Key Fob: This innovative key allows keyless entry and starting of your automobile.

    Knowing the kind of key you need will significantly enhance your look for a replacement.

    Finding a Replacement Key for Your Volvo V50

    1. Contact Your Local Volvo Dealership

    The most reputable, albeit potentially the most pricey, alternative is to contact your regional Volvo dealership. They have the proper devices to configure your new key, ensuring it works flawlessly with your automobile.

    • Advantages:
      • Guaranteed compatibility and security.
      • Access to O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ts.
    • Downsides:
      • Higher cost compared to other alternatives.
      • May need the automobile to be present for programming.

    2. Use an Automotive Locksmith

    A qualified automotive locksmith can often produce a replacement key for your Volvo V50 without involving the dealer. They can aid with both conventional and transponder key replacements.

    • Benefits:
      • Typically more economical than a dealer.
      • Can frequently provide mobile services that concern you.
    • Drawbacks:
      • Quality may differ based upon locksmith experience.
      • Not all locksmith professionals can configure clever keys.

    Important Considerations When Replacing Your Key

    • Recognition: Regardless of where you go, you’ll typically require to provide evidence of ownership, such as the car title or registration.
    • VIN Number: Have your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) prepared as this is essential for key programming.
    • Cost Estimates: Below is a cost comparison for various key replacement alternatives.

    Service Provider
    Estimated Cost
    Time Required

    Regional Dealership
    ₤ 200 – ₤ 500 (depending on key type)
    1-2 hours

    Automotive Locksmith
    ₤ 100 – ₤ 300
    30 – 60 minutes

    Online Services
    ₤ 50 – ₤ 200
    Varies (Shipping times)

    FAQs About Replacing Your Volvo V50 Key

    Q1: How much does it cost to replace a Volvo V50 key?A1: The cost can range from ₤ 100 at a locksmith to ₤ 500 at a car dealership, depending on the kind of key (conventional, transponder, or clever key) and who you select as your service provider.

    Q2: Can I set a new key myself?A2: Generally, it’s suggested to have a locksmith or dealer carry out programming considering that it needs customized devices.

    Q3: What should I do if I lose my only key?A3: It’s finest to contact a dealer or a trusted automobile locksmith instantly to avoid any problems with accessing your lorry.

    Q4: How long does it take to get a replacement key?A4: Depending on the service picked, it can take anywhere from 30 minutes to a couple of hours.
